The idea of creating paintings from your photographs may be the wrong one to assume. It is interesting, but as everything in life, it has to embraced with caution.

I remember, years ago, before all this digital wizardry was possible, how a photographer I knew fell in love with the basic filters available in Photoshop. Suddenly he discovered all he wanted to be was a painter. And although he could not even do a straight line with a brush, he started to churn out image after image transformed into paintings, through Photoshop, happy to receive compliments from people who said, over and over, "nice. It looks like a painting". Not understanding, that the worst compliment a photographer can have is to hear someone say "our photograph looks like a painting". Unless, that's what they're aiming for...

So, from my point of view, you have to be careful when you, as a photographer, want to use Topaz Simplify. I know my share of people who once they find filters like those included in the Topaz Simplify pack think they've found the Holy Grail for their stardom path. They've not. Filters, be it the old Cokin filters so many misused, or those modern digital filters, are no way to transform a bad photograph into a master piece. They'll embellish it somehow, but do not make you a better photographer. They are to be used with parsimony.

Topaz Simplify gives you a shortcut to be more creative with some of your images, a starting point to explore, and it does not mean you just have to transform photographs into paintings. In fact you can also create sketches, watercolors, cartoons, and more, make your art uniquely personal instead of using cookie-cutter filters and get better results faster with specialized digital art technology.

So, Topaz Simplify - or any other program of its kind, in fact - should be used as an extension of your vision, to present interesting ways to show your photographs, but not as a crutch to hide bad photographs, repeatedly used... in a cookie cutter style. Because, especially in these Internet and digital times, I do feel that many special effects used are just a way for people to share bad photographs transformed into something that was not there to start with. And that does not much for photography!
